Explore the battlefields where the Anzac legend began on our 5-day Gallipoli Discovery Tour
Walk in the footsteps on the original Anzacs on the most sacred Australian battlefield – Gallipoli. Our 5-day visits all the key sites where the Anzacs fought and died and includes numerous bonus visits not included in other tours! The itinerary has been personally designed by Mat McLachlan, and the tour is escorted by an expert Australian battlefield historian.
The meeting point is the Kent Hotel Istanbul.
This morning we depart Istanbul and drive to the Gallipoli peninsula. As we travel along the shores of the Sea of Marmara, we will discuss the history of the campaign and the vital importance of the waters of the Dardanelles to the aims and outcomes of the battle. On arrival in the seaside town of Çanakkale we will visit the old Turkish fort at Cimenlik, which played a key role in the naval attacks of March 1915. We will enjoy dinner together this evening. (D)
OVERNIGHT: Çanakkale
We will explore the scene of famous actions during the Gallipoli Campaign, such as Anzac Cove, Lone Pine, Quinn’s Post, Chunuk Bair and many more. As the story of the campaign unfolds, we will learn the stories of the men who were there, on the ground where they fought and died. A highlight will be a visit to the recently uncovered trenches at Silt Spur, where we will have the opportunity to explore a complete Australian trench system that has been hidden for over a century. At the end of this memorable day we will return to Çanakkale, where our evening is free. (B, L)
OVERNIGHT: Çanakkale
It’s time to strap our walking boots on as we leave the well-trodden paths of Gallipoli and see the battlefield as the Anzacs did. Our touring coach will drive us to the Anzac sector, where we will enjoy two very special walks to parts of the battlefields rarely seen by tourists. Our first walk will take us from Shrapnel Valley, up onto Braund’s Hill and along the ridgelines towards the front line at Lone Pine. During this walk we will be following in the footsteps of the Anzacs and gaining a fascinating new perspective on the battlefield. After a picnic lunch we will drive to the heights of Chunuk Bair, where New Zealand troops fought bravely in August 1915. We will then walk down to the beach via Rhododendron Ridge, covering the same ground that New Zealand troops captured during their advance in 1915. We will have magnificent views of the tangle of gullies and ravines north of the Anzac Sector, where some of the toughest fighting of the August campaign occurred. This is one of the most scenic walks at Gallipoli, and one rarely seen by visitors to the region. At the end of this fascinating day we will return to our hotel, where our evening is free. (B, L)
OVERNIGHT: Çanakkale
Today we will head to Cape Helles, located on the southern toe of the peninsula. We will explore the British and French battlefields, the scene of more than 30,000 deaths in just 10 months of fighting. While here we will explore V Beach, W Beach the Cape Helles Memorial, Achi Baba, and many more famous battlefields. We will also explore the forgotten Anzac attack at Krithia, as well as seeing several hidden sites not normally accessible by tourists. Whilst in the area we will enjoy lunch at a wonderful local restaurant in Eceabat. (B, L)
OVERNIGHT: Çanakkale
Our last day at Gallipoli will take us to another battlefield from another time, the famous ancient city of Troy. We will enjoy a guided tour of the ruins and hear the fabulous story of ancient battles and the famous Trojan Horse. Lunch will be at a local restaurant in Troy, where we may have the opportunity of meeting local author and Troy, expert Mustafa Askin. We will also visit some Turkish gun emplacements from the Gallipoli campaign. In the afternoon we will return to Istanbul at approximately 7:30pm, where sadly our tour will end. The drop off hotel is The Kent Hotel Istanbul. (B)
